Artificial Intelligence (AI) has revolutionized many fields in recent years, and IT maintenance is no exception. Indeed, AI is increasingly being used to improve the operational efficiency of IT maintenance teams. In this article, we explore the latest AI trends in IT maintenance and how they are helping to simplify the management of complex IT systems.
One of the most powerful applications of AI in IT maintenance is proactive fault detection. Instead of simply reacting to problems when they occur, AI systems can continuously analyze IT system performance data and identify early signs of failure. This enables maintenance teams to take preventive action to avoid costly downtime and minimize disruption to end users.
AI algorithms use machine learning techniques to analyze the behavioral patterns of computer systems. They can detect subtle anomalies that usually escape the human eye, making proactive maintenance more effective than ever.
Another major AI trend in IT maintenance is the automation of routine tasks. IT maintenance teams often spend a lot of time performing repetitive tasks such as updating software, managing security patches and monitoring performance. AI can automate these tasks, allowing technicians to concentrate on more complex, high-value-added tasks.
AI-powered chatbots and virtual agents are increasingly being used to provide basic technical support and answer questions frequently asked by end users. This reduces the workload on IT support teams and enables common problems to be resolved quickly.
AI can also be used to optimize the use of IT resources. AI systems can monitor demand for IT resources in real time, and automatically allocate resources to maximize efficiency while minimizing costs. For example, if a server is under-utilized at any given time, AI can allocate its resources to other tasks that need them, reducing waste and delivering a better return on investment.
What's more, AI can help maintenance teams plan updates and upgrades more efficiently by analyzing historical performance data and identifying when service interruptions will have the least impact. on operations.
Cybersecurity is a major concern for all organizations, and AI has become an essential tool for strengthening the security of IT systems. AI systems can monitor network activity in real time and detect suspicious real-world behavior that could indicate a cyber attack. They can also analyze large quantities of data to identify potential vulnerabilities in systems and applications.
In addition, AI can be used to automate response to security incidents. It can take immediate action to mitigate attacks, such as quarantining compromised systems or blocking malicious traffic.
Finally, AI can provide valuable decision-making support in the field of IT maintenance. By analyzing performance data and historical trends, AI systems can help managers make informed decisions on IT asset management, budget planning and technology investments.
Artificial Intelligence is essentially transforming the field of IT maintenance. The latest trends in AI offer significant benefits, with these advances enabling IT maintenance teams to become more efficient, responsive and proactive in managing complex IT systems.
However, it is essential to note that the adoption of AI in IT maintenance is not limited to the implementation of cutting-edge technologies. It also requires a thorough understanding of the organization's specific needs, adequate staff training and judicious data management. What's more, it's important to keep an eye on developments in AI, as this field is constantly evolving.
